3D printers require parts to be made with close tolerances and constructed of premium materials. Something manufacturers of these printers do not understand these days. Simply too much cost cutting.
3D printing can and does work in closely monitored production environments.
But you know how it goes, it was hyped to all hell and back. And when that happens you know, just know, that you're getting in on something someone wants to become "big" and pervasive throughout the industry. Yet it is still in its infancy.
It was kind of like that with Digital Cameras and SSD. First now digital cameras are coming into their own. And SSD has another year to go.
It's like that with anything "tech". You get vocal loudmouthed evangelists singing the praises of whatever it is they're pitching and you're left holding the bag. Remember 3D TV?? What became of that?
The only two major advances worthy of television are increased resolution and refresh rates. Everything else is hype.

Stella generated a .dat file that worked, but on older 140 version. It did not generate any file on 152. I set the bank to FA2. No change.
Also, you must reset the game or reload it in order for the difficulty switches to take effect. I'm just used to flipping them in-game.Never mind that, you just have to RESTART the game by either playing it till you lose all your lives or hit the RESET switch. That's not so bad.
-
Regarding the high score, that will never work well on Harmony. The binary is meant for Stella and the cart. There the high score will be stored permanently, even if you switch of the emulator or console.
That doesn't seem to work on my Stella setup for some unknown reason. Is it supposed to store it in a separate file somehow? Or in the ROM itself?
